Assessing Your Lawn and Planning the Design

When you're all set to mount an automatic sprinkler, the initial step is reviewing your yard and planning the layout. Start by observing the shapes and size of your lawn. Determine areas that need watering, such as flower beds, lawns, and vegetable yards. Make note of sunlight direct exposure and any kind of shaded places, as these variables affect water requirements.

Following, think about the water pressure available to you. Examine it utilizing a basic pressure gauge to validate your system can work efficiently. Plan the positioning of sprinkler heads based upon insurance coverage; you'll want them to overlap slightly to stay clear of completely dry patches.

Lay out a harsh layout, noting the places of the main lines and lawn sprinkler heads. Think of the types of sprinklers you'll use and their reach. Preparation meticulously currently will make your installment much easier and verify your plants obtain the correct amount of water.

Identifying Trench Depth

Determining the right trench depth is essential for guaranteeing your lawn sprinkler system works successfully. Normally, you'll intend to dig trenches that site about 6 to 12 inches deep, depending on your neighborhood environment and the kind of pipes you're making use of. Much deeper trenches assist avoid pipelines from cold if you live in an area with freezing temperature levels. Be certain to take into account the size of your pipelines; bigger pipes might call for much deeper trenches for proper installment. Furthermore, examine regional codes or policies, as they might dictate specific deepness requirements. As you dig, maintain the trench width convenient-- around 12 inches is usually sufficient. In this manner, you can conveniently install and access the pipelines when needed, guaranteeing your system operates efficiently.

Installing Lawn Sprinkler People and Valves

Installing lawn sprinkler heads and valves is an essential action in creating an effective watering system for your lawn or garden (Fast sprinkler repair). Begin by positioning the lawn sprinkler heads at the significant places, ensuring they're uniformly spaced for ideal protection. Dig a little opening for each and every head, confirming it's deep enough for appropriate setup

Following, attach the sprinkler heads to the pipes, safeguarding them snugly to avoid leaks. Usage Teflon tape on the threads for additional guarantee.

When it comes to valves, select a place conveniently obtainable for maintenance. Set up the valves according to the maker's guidelines, attaching them to the mainline pipelines. Make sure they're level and secure, as this will aid with constant water flow.

Lastly, examination each sprinkler head and valve for appropriate function before burying any pipes. This step warranties your system runs efficiently and successfully, supplying the finest take care of your plants.

How much time Does It Usually Require To Set Up an Automatic Sprinkler?

Commonly, installing an automatic sprinkler takes anywhere from one to three days, depending on your yard's size and complexity. If you're doing it yourself or hiring help., you'll desire to intend for added time.

Can I Mount a Lawn Sprinkler Throughout Wintertime?

You can mount a lawn sprinkler during winter season, however it's difficult. Cold temperatures can freeze pipelines, making installment hard. If you pick to proceed, ensure you're prepared for potential complications and protect your tools adequately.

What Is the Ordinary Expense of a New Sprinkler System?

The average price of a brand-new sprinkler system typically varies between $2,000 and $4,000, depending on your backyard size and system intricacy. You'll intend to obtain several quotes to locate the very best option for you.

Exist Eco-Friendly Options for Sprinkler Equipments?

Yes, there are environment-friendly options for lawn sprinkler systems. You can choose drip watering, rain sensing units, or clever controllers that enhance water use and decrease waste, aiding you maintain a lavish garden while being ecologically aware.

Exactly how Usually Should I Preserve My Lawn Sprinkler System?

You ought to keep your automatic sprinkler a minimum of twice a year-- when in springtime and once in autumn. Regular checks assist assure efficiency, stop leaks, and maintain your grass healthy, saving you time and cash in the future.
